Theme: The Use of PC Notation Software as Aid for Music Instruction

OCSAT opened its first School Learning Action Cell (SLAC) session on
June 30, 2017. To facilitate the many needs of training our teachers need to
be enhances, this year's SLAC is divided into three highlighting on:
Facilitative Learning, Revisiting DLL/DLP Making and Using Apps to
Integrate Music Teaching.

Team SLAC C consisting of all MAPEH Teachers was assigned on the


conduct on using apps to integrate music teaching with the theme: The Use
of PC Music Notation Software as Aid for Music Instruction.

The session opened with the topic of Sir Ket Ian Cotales on the
Introduction to Music Apps, PC Notation Software. He emphasized the
importance of technology on the integration of Music Teaching. The use of
apps have been an essential tool already to teach music in the classroom.

Afterwhich, Sir Rotello Boligor II continued the session on the


workshop on Basic Computer Encoding of Music Notation and MIDI/Audio
conversion to MP3. The teachers were exposed to the steps in encoding
music sheets online and was able to play simple pieces without even a
background in music; just technology and perseverance to learn.

After the music workshop, Sir Assadik Ditual Jr opened another


session which is on Dance. From his lecture, the participants were
introduced on the basic dance step of folk dance. The participants were
also able to perform simple folk dance steps which is a product of their
desire to learn the art.

The day ended with a lot of learning which our participants will bring
to their respective classrooms.
